a card game in the poker family where each player is dealt four private cards face down and must build a hand using exactly two of them together with three of five shared cards turned face up in the middle of the table.

用法筆記

Often capitalised as 'Omaha' because the name comes from a place. The full label is 'Omaha hold'em', and the most common variants are 'pot-limit Omaha' (PLO) and 'Omaha hi-lo'. Always uncountable when naming the game itself, but countable in phrases like 'a hand of omaha' or 'an omaha table'.

In omaha you can use any number of your hole cards.
In omaha you must use exactly two of your hole cards.
💡this two-card rule is the defining difference from Texas hold'em.
